Microsoft has agreed to buy a $50 million parcel of land in southeastern Wisconsin meant for Foxconn

MADISON, Wis. — Microsoft MSFT has agreed to buy a $50 million parcel of land in southeastern Wisconsin meant for Foxconn after the world’s largest electronics manufacturer failed to fulfill grandiose promises to build a massive facility that would employ thousands of workers.

The village already is home to a Foxconn Technology Group 2354 manufacturing facility. The Taiwan-based company is best known for making Apple iPhones. The company announced plans in 2017 to build a $10 billion facility in Mount Pleasant that would employ 13,000 people. According to a fact sheet describing the Microsoft project compiled by southeastern Wisconsin economic development groups, the 315-acre parcel is part of a tax-increment financing district that includes the Foxconn campus. Property taxes collected in such districts can be used to subsidize development in the district.
